HONKID Switch Opener Aluminum Keyboard Switch Opener for Cherry MX Gateron Kailh Box Outemu Akko and Panda Mechanical Switches with Metal Magnet (Grey) Stabilizers are a essential keyboard component placed under the larger keys such as space bar, backspace, and shift, to keep the keys from shaking, rattling, and tilting while typing. The stabilizers keep the keys balanced so you can have a stabletyping and gaming experience. See more There are a few different stabilizer types out there, Cherry style, Costar, and Optical. They are each significantly different, so we’ll explain what makes them unique. See more There are three stabilizer sizes you can purchase: 7u, 6.25u, and 2u. The stabilizers follow the same measuring system as keycaps, where 1u = the width of one keycap.
